Header di risposta
Un header di risposta è un HTTP header (en-US) che può essere utilizzato in una risposta HTTP e che non fa riferimento al contenuto del messaggio. Gli header di risposta, come Age
, Location (en-US) o Server
sono usati per fornire un contesto della risposta più dettagliato.
Non tutti gli header che compaiono in una risposta sono header di risposta. Ad esempio, l'header Content-Length (en-US) è un entity header (en-US) che fa riferimento alla dimensione del corpo del messaggio di risposta. Tuttavia queste entità sono chiamate solitamente header di risposta in questo contesto.
Di seguito sono mostrati alcuni header di risposta dopo una richiesta GET (en-US) . Si noti che, strettamente parlando, gli header Content-Encoding (en-US) e Content-Type (en-US) sono entity headers:
200 OK Access-Control-Allow-Origin: * Connection: Keep-Alive Content-Encoding: gzip Content-Type: text/html; charset=utf-8 Date: Mon, 18 Jul 2016 16:06:00 GMT Etag: "c561c68d0ba92bbeb8b0f612a9199f722e3a621a" Keep-Alive: timeout=5, max=997 Last-Modified: Mon, 18 Jul 2016 02:36:04 GMT Server: Apache Set-Cookie: mykey=myvalue; expires=Mon, 17-Jul-2017 16:06:00 GMT; Max-Age=31449600; Path=/; secure Transfer-Encoding: chunked Vary: Cookie, Accept-Encoding X-Backend-Server: developer2.webapp.scl3.mozilla.com X-Cache-Info: not cacheable; meta data too large X-kuma-revision: 1085259 x-frame-options: DENY